Council Minutes of 3-03-2020 <br />authorize the settlement he will come back to Council to get authorization <br />depending on how much will be involved. <br />Director of Finance Copfer: <br />• Last Tuesday, the City sold the new money capital notes. She said it was a good <br />time to sell. She said there were five investors who wanted to buy the entire <br />amount. She said each took 115 of the issue. Director Copfer said the yield was <br />1.1% and with all the costs included, which is called the all in interest cost, the <br />total rate paying all in is 1.77 percent and the coupon is 2% which was sold at a <br />premium. <br />Council President Jones, Committee of the Whole: <br />The Committee of the Whole met on Tuesday, February 25, 2020 at 8:00 p.m. Present <br />were Council members Brossard, Glassbum, Hemann, Limpert and Williamson; Council <br />President Jones; Director of Finance Copfer, Director of Human Resources Gallo, <br />Director of Safety & Service Glauner, Director of Planning & Community Development <br />Lieber and guests. <br />• Council met regarding the City's text messaging system due to a message that <br />was sent out that many Councilmembers felt was an inappropriate use of City <br />resources. The Council asked to have a written policy on the use of the City text <br />message system and all means of communications with residents within the next <br />three weeks. <br />Councilwoman Williamson Chairwoman of the Building, Zoning & Development <br />Committee: <br />The Building, Zoning & Development Committee met on Tuesday, February 25, 2020 at <br />7:40 p.m. Present were committee members Williamson and Limpert; Councilmembers <br />Brossard, Glassburn and Hemann; Council President Jones; Director of Finance Copfer, <br />Director of Human Resources Gallo, Director of Safety & Service Glauner, Director of <br />Planning and Community Development Lieber and guests. <br />• Discussed was Ordinance 2020-19. An Ordinance amending Chapter 1149 <br />"Mixed Use Districts" of Chapter Eleven of the Codified Ordinances of the City <br />of North Olmsted titled "Planning and Zoning Code," for the purpose of <br />implementing Zoning Code changes proposed by the City of North Olmsted <br />Planning and Design Commission. A Public Hearing was held prior to this <br />meeting. Director Lieber said it would correct various issues within the Code such <br />as: the non-existence of mixed use B districts; the development review process is <br />different than any other non-residential district regulated by Chapter 1126; mixed <br />use A allows any use in the general retail business district which no longer exists <br />since the 2017 Zoning Update and would not be desirable due to the focus on <br />retail; there are no specific landscaping standards and parking regulations are <br />inconsistent with Chapter 1161. Changes to Chapter 1149 will also make its <br />format consistent with other Code sections to include color coding as it relates to <br />the current Zoning Code.
